POSITION OVERVIEW
We are seeking an experienced Field Service Technician to diagnose, repair, and maintain CNC milling and turning machines at customer facilities. This role involves both mechanical and electrical troubleshooting, requiring a solid understanding of mechanical systems, CNC controls, and electro-mechanical assemblies. Preferred mechanical experience:
- Diagnose and repair CNC milling and turning machines at customer locations.
- Troubleshoot and repair automatic tool changers, pallet systems, spindles, and turret mechanisms.
- Perform ball screw and axis support bearing replacements and alignments.
- Repair and align hydraulic and pneumatic systems.
- Read and interpret mechanical drawings and part prints to execute precise repairs.
-Preferred electrical experience:
- Troubleshoot electrical and electronic systems, including CNC controls and electro-mechanical assemblies.
- Read and follow ladder and wiring diagrams to diagnose issues.
- Utilize tools such as digital multimeters, ohmmeters, and phase checkers for troubleshooting.
- Repair CNC controls, including Fanuc systems, and perform programming as needed.
